This is a beautiful campground centrally located between Bryce and Escalante parks. Perfect spot to explore both. As full time travelers we depend on cell service for our jobs. The reviews say there are 2 bars of AT&T and 2 bars of Verizon. Unfortunately this isn’t accurate. AT&T no service. Verizon 1 bar LTE. We drove to Tropic an... more
This is a beautiful campground centrally located between Bryce and Escalante parks. Perfect spot to explore both.
As full time travelers we depend on cell service for our jobs. The reviews say there are 2 bars of AT&T and 2 bars of Verizon. Unfortunately this isn’t accurate. AT&T no service. Verizon 1 bar LTE. We drove to Tropic and was able to get 3G AT&T.
We had a site by the main road and we were not bothered by the road noise. It’s was minimal.

We selected the KOA Cannonville for its proximity to Bryce Canyon National Park. This would be our first ever full hook up (with sewer) experience as newbie travel trailer owners. This location is roughly 20 minutes from the Bryce Canyon entrance. It also is conveniently located to Kodachrome Basin State Park, which we also took a... more
We selected the KOA Cannonville for its proximity to Bryce Canyon National Park. This would be our first ever full hook up (with sewer) experience as newbie travel trailer owners.
This location is roughly 20 minutes from the Bryce Canyon entrance. It also is conveniently located to Kodachrome Basin State Park, which we also took advantage of visiting during our stay in the area.
Pulling into the KOA, we stopped first at the lobby area to check in. We were then escorted to our campsite. This was very helpful in navigating to the correct site and we appreciated the offer from the staff.
The paths for vehicles including the sites at this KOA are gravel. We drove slow for our travels in and out. We had a pull thru site which fit our 27 foot trailer well. The site had a picnic table and fire pit. We didn’t use the latter however as during our stay, the winds were fairly robust – too much so to enjoy behind outside for an extended period of time.
The main building at the front of the facility has a smallish store which offers a good variety of numerous camping supplies. There is also a modest selection of food products available. We frequented the store for milk to spill into our morning coffees and some of the 5% ABV Utah beer. The lobby area also offers numerous pamphlets with ideas for things to do in the area during your stay.
Behind the store area in the same building, are showers and bathrooms. I believe these showers are open 24x7. We used these showers nightly versus the shower in our RV (which has still to be used for the first time). The shower stalls are a bit tight, but this is a good option as an alternative for showers.
We did find the wifi connectivity barely usable. It seemed better in the early morning (perhaps when fewer people were vying for connectivity). By evening time, I would be barely able to access emails. Beyond that – websites, newspapers, etc., forget it.
Staff was courteous and helpful. Location was convenient to several things to do in the area. We enjoyed our stay.
